Nik's i9000 Snapseed for Mac pc provides all the greatest bits of the popular iOS application to Mac pc and PC desktops Photo editing software program manufacturer Nik offers been making programs and plug-ins for digital photographers with heavy wallets for years. Their collection of plugins fór Aperture, Lightroom, ánd Photoshop expenses a whopping $599 but their status is mainly because great as their price tags. Their Efex Professional editing series has gained the praise of both specialists and enthusiasts searching to create their pictures pop. Following the discharge of in 2011, Nik has started venturing into the even more inexpensive stand-alone programs.

PC and Mac pc variations of the Snapseed were announced previously this season, and the Mac pc version rapidly grew to become one of the greatest selling Photo publishers in the App Store. At $19.99, it expenses $5 even more than Apple's iPhoto but is usually still very much cheaper than Apérture and Photoshop Components and $4 cheaper than. The PC version costs exactly the same quantity. We're examining the Macintosh version right here, and the 1st factor that's obvious is definitely how similar Snapseed's i9000 interface is certainly to the cellular version for iOS. It includes all of the tools that iPhone and iPad users have arrive to rely on like as U-Point technologies for accuracy exposure editing as well as color changes and a range of customizable vintage photograph effects. Tuning I started in the 'Melody Picture' section to make basic adjustments.

Here, Snapseed offers six, pre-made exposure changes - automated, neutral, darkish, bright, balanced, and moody. Thé auto-effects are usually noticeable in the thumbnail. Once you possess selected an impact, you can more alter the Lighting, Contrast, Vividness, Atmosphere, and Comfort of your photograph by toggling sIiders in the 'Global Adjust' section of the windowpane. (Atmosphere appears to be a mixture of shadow darkening and colour temperature and Heat is color stability). The U-Point controls are altered by hitting and dragging your cursor tó either the best or still left of the control keys.

(Remaining to decrease the intensity and ideal to enhance it.) You can discover how much you are impacting your picture by the coloured bands that will appear around the letter you possess chosen. The begin of a crimson circle around 'G', for illustration, indicates you have reduced the contrast and a reddish colored circle indicates you possess improved it. The 'Track Image' area is usually where you will discover Snapseed's i9000 U-Point technology. To make use of U-Point, you click the 'Add Control Point' choice in the cell. Following, you select the region that you wish to have an effect on.

I selected the darkish history of my family portrait. From here, you can change the range of the affected area by hitting on size button below yóur U-Point. After choosing your area size, you can adjust 'W', 'M', or 'S' - for lighting, contrast, and vividness.

After you have got made the decision on your adjustment, look longer and hard at the adjustments you have made. Once you use a filtration system, you cannot Undo just one stage, you must start from scuff. You can undo adjustments from within a filtration system editor, but once you have got used them, you are out of luck if you modify your brain. When you are usually ready, click on the 'Apply' arrów on the bottom part left of the window. For my 10.1 MB.NEF document, the edits had taken 10 secs to proceed through (5 secs for a 950 KB.JPEG). At any point in an editing process, you can take a look at your authentic picture by clicking the 'compare' image on the tóp-right of thé display screen. Details Apart from exposure controls, Snapseed also offers advanced sharpness and comparison adjustments in their 'Information' section.

Right here, you can modify the sharpness and framework of your picture. In this instance, I needed to bring out the information in my subject matter's tresses. I finished up not really keeping the changes, even though, because what had been improved in the framework of the locks also made the delicate ranges in my subject matter's face super harsh.

The U Point technology would be a excellent inclusion to this area so professional photographers could selectively bring up the details without sharpening the entire photo. Popping and Straightening After you are finished doing your simple tune-up, it is usually time to determine precisely how significantly of your photograph is required for the composition. In the 'Bounty and Straighten' tab, you view your picture in a grid and use either the position slider or arróws on the edges of the photo to straighten your chance. You can crop your photo making use of its first aspect percentage, choosing one of thé six pre-madé proportions, or free-styling it. A rule-of-thirds grid is usually superimposed on your photograph at all moments during the crópping and straightening process so you will under no circumstances forget about what you had been trained in Photograph 101. Centering Snapseed offers several different focusing features. Its 'Middle Concentrate' tab starts up to six various focusing styles - Blur, Vignette, Aged Lens, Foggy, Black and Bright.

The some other choice for concentrating in Snapseed is the 'TiIt-shift' simulator. TiIt-shift or smaller mimickers are usually abut as common as the sepia filtration system in well-known cameras apps but unlike the added materials and color manipulators, tilt-shifting can put in some drama without switching your photograph into a blown-out mess. Each of these styles is applied by choosing a single focal stage and adjusting the size of thé in-focus rádius around that point. You can after that change the quantity of blur ánd vignette that wiIl end up being applied to the shot. In the tiIt-shift simulator, yóu can select between either linear or radial focal aeroplanes and you can change the middle and dimension of your tilt-shifted zone. For my photograph, I very first used a 'dark' Middle Focus filtration system before including a circular tilt-shift coating - each a single with the focal stage on my model's nose and the band of concentrate ending at the advantage of her mind.

My objective with these filter systems has been to get the focus away from the distracting coloured pillar the left of my model. It would end up being nice to possess the option in one Snapseed'beds focusing filters to select even more than one focal point or to use the U-Point technology to choose a focal colour instead of just choosing one radial place.

I would have got liked to just select my design's epidermis color for a precise, subtle concentrate, but I has been pressured to include some encircling places. Lo-Fi and Play Filters Cue the gróans of a miIlion image purists. Snapseed offers four filtration system categories for the digital photographer who pines for the glory times of Holga ánd Diana. The 'Black Light' tab will consider you to a windowpane where you can adapt the brightness, contrast, and hemp of your now black and white picture. You can furthermore choose either a red, orange, yellow, or natural color filtration system that will further specialize your effect.

'Theatre' will boost the saturation of your picture and provide it a quasi-HDR impact. In small doses, this filter provides a specific je-ne-sáis-quói, but in Iarge dosages, your scene risks switching into something from Alice't vacation to Wonderland.

'Grunge' will exactly what you think it does. It will make your photos look mainly because dirty as Kurt Cobain's hair. Right here, you can apply tipped and wrinkIy-paper textures simply because nicely as adjust the vividness, brightness, and comparison in its six different styles. 'Vintage' has nine movie styles with variable vignettes, papers textures and vividness to make your photo look like a color film printing from the 50't, 60't or 70'h. You knowif you're also into that type of point.

For my picture, I scaled dówn the 'Wes' impact in the 'Classic' filter selection to the point where it had been barely obvious at used it to include a little essence to my picture. Frames As soon as you have finished editing your picture, you can put it in a frame. Snapseed has 10 customizable frames that differ from the basic white heart stroke line to a spectacular and cut paper imitator.

Each framework's dimension, spread, and grunginess can end up being adjusted using sliders and if you are usually feeling insane, there can be a shuffle choice that will randomly create a body for you. For my picture, I decided a paper-mimickér and scaIed it down só it isn't very distracting. Expressing At any stage between filter edits, you can File >Save As and Snapseed will conserve your photograph in the same measurements that it began at. When you are completed, you can printing, or share to the internet straight from the app. Snapseed is currently suitable with Facebook and Flickr spreading as well as through email. Bottom line: Nik has used its expertise in desktop computer plug-ins to consider its inexpensive mobile app to a fresh level. Snapseed is certainly simple to make use of and can generate high-quality edits quickly.

It can furthermore be integrated into a workflow concentrated around Apple Aperture and Adobé Photoshop Lightroom (ánd we can hope iPhoto in the future). I would like to see Nik make use of Snapseed's helpful U-Point technology even more in the concentrate and details control though. The consumer interface of Snapseed for Mac/PC is certainly extremely related to the iPad edition but has a few welcome changes - for one, you can actually focus in on your photos - a function that is definitely frustratingly lacking from the iOS version of the ápp. The app furthermore runs more quickly on a powerful desktop personal computer, and applying pictures and saving takes much less time on our 27iin iMac than it will on a Iatest-generation iPad.

Nevertheless missing, unfortunately, will be a group processing function, but general Snapseed will be a great app when it arrives to producing your photos unique without getting to spend hrs in Photoshop ór oversimplify your photos in a lo-fi publisher. We including: U-point settings, Aperture and Lightroom integration, thumbnail previews of results, adjustable lo-fi filter systems and structures, focus handle We put on't like (Relatively) sluggish processing instances for large files, U-Point controls not used in some results.
